Q: Is 30,219,007 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 30,219,007 is not a prime number.

Why is 30,219,007 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 30219007 can be evenly divided by 1 7 13 73 91 511 949 4,549 6,643 31,843 59,137 332,077 413,959 2,324,539 4,317,001 and 30,219,007, with no remainder.

Since 30,219,007 cannot be divided by just 1 and 30,219,007, it is not a prime number.
